SMILE Eye Surgery Overview



If you're thinking about SMILE eye surgical treatment, you'll find it to be a minimally invasive procedure with a quick recuperation time. During SMILE (Little Incision Lenticule Extraction), a laser is made use of to create a tiny, precise laceration in the cornea to get rid of a little item of cells, improving it to correct your vision. This differs from LASIK, where a flap is created, and PRK, where the outer layer of the cornea is entirely removed.

Among the essential benefits of SMILE is its minimally invasive nature, bring about a faster healing process and less discomfort post-surgery. The healing time for SMILE is relatively fast, with lots of patients experiencing enhanced vision within a day or more. This makes it a prominent option for those looking for a practical and effective vision improvement treatment. In addition, SMILE has been shown to have a lower danger of completely dry eye disorder compared to LASIK, making it a desirable option for individuals concerned regarding this prospective negative effects.

Distinctions In Between SMILE, LASIK, and PRK



When comparing SMILE, LASIK, and PRK eye surgeries, it is necessary to understand the unique strategies used in each procedure for vision modification.

SMILE (Small Laceration Lenticule Removal) is a minimally intrusive treatment that involves developing a tiny laceration to remove a lenticule from the cornea, reshaping it to fix vision.

LASIK (Laser-Assisted Sitting Keratomileusis) includes developing a slim flap on the cornea, utilizing a laser to improve the underlying cells, and after that repositioning the flap.

PRK (Photorefractive Keratectomy) eliminates the outer layer of the cornea prior to improving the cells with a laser.

The main difference depends on the way the cornea is accessed and treated. SMILE is flapless, making it a great alternative for people with slim corneas or those involved in get in touch with sports. LASIK uses fast visual recuperation because of the flap production, yet it might present a greater risk of flap-related issues. Advantages And Disadvantages Comparison



To assess the advantages and downsides of SMILE, LASIK, and PRK eye surgical procedures, it's vital to think about the certain benefits and potential constraints of each procedure. SMILE surgical procedure uses the benefit of a minimally intrusive procedure, with a smaller sized cut and possibly quicker healing time contrasted to LASIK and PRK. It likewise lowers the threat of completely dry eye post-surgery, an usual adverse effects of LASIK. However, SMILE might have constraints in treating higher degrees of myopia or astigmatism compared to LASIK.

LASIK surgical procedure offers fast visual recovery and minimal pain throughout the procedure. It's very reliable in treating a variety of refractive mistakes, consisting of nearsightedness, hyperopia, and astigmatism. Yet, LASIK lugs a threat of flap complications, which can impact the corneal framework.

PRK eye surgery, while not as preferred as LASIK, avoids creating a corneal flap, decreasing the danger of flap-related complications. It's suitable for patients with thin corneas or uneven corneal surface areas. Nevertheless, PRK has a much longer recovery time and may involve extra pain during the healing procedure.
